Talking How do I set up, or check, a network log to see when my network card disconnects?


I'm using Linux mint, but I'd like to be able to check my other networked machines as well.

It seems like my machine always experiences one full disconnect/reconnect every time it wakes from sleep. This happens while I'm playing Overwatch through Lutris, not sure if that's related or not.

Basically what I want to do is check some kind of log to tell me why this is happening and I also want to check and see if it makes my other devices on my network go down at the same time, because that would leave me to believe my router (Edgerouter x) might be the issue.

Any tips?

Examine the journal logging.

If using NetworkManager, you could do
Code:
sudo journalctl -u NetworkManager
To watch on the fly in a terminal
Code:
sudo journalctl -fu NetworkManager
